We are seeking a creative and inspiring Lecturer who can deliver engaging classes to learners who are based within the prison. As an English Lecturer, you will be supporting learners to achieve success and guiding them through Functional Skills courses. You will not only help them to achieve qualifications, but also confidence and skills they can apply to employment upon release, or to other areas within education. The College works to reduce re‑offending by providing learners with opportunities to learn and develop skills. We would like you to be part of the learner’s journey, providing them with a positive learning experience. ✨Prepare for Adult Education Methodologies
Be ready to dive into your knowledge of andragogy and educational theories during the interview. Expect questions about how you would adapt your teaching styles for adult learners – think about specific strategies you’ve used in the past and be prepared to discuss how they positively impacted your students.
